Adjective [Spanish]

IPA: /koˈbaɾde/, [koˈβ̞aɾ.ð̞e] Forms: cobardes [feminine, masculine, plural]
Rhymes: -aɾde Etymology: Borrowed from French couard, from Old French cuard. Etymology templates: {{bor+|es|fr|couard}} Borrowed from French couard, {{der|es|fro|cuard}} Old French cuard Head templates: {{es-adj}} cobarde m or f (masculine and feminine plural cobardes)
  1. cowardly, craven, gutless, spineless, dastardly Tags: feminine, masculine
